About this Dataset
Liechtenstein recorded 1 % of GDP in 2023. The latest change was -0.1pp. Across 2013–2023 the series ranges from 0.8 in 2014 to 1.2 in 2020.
This page tracks government and compulsory prepaid health expenditure as a percentage of GDP in Liechtenstein from 2005 to present.
Data sourced from Eurostat via SDMX REST API. Values use harmonised methodology intended for cross-country comparison.
